Skip to content
El Paraiso Landscaping
Open Button
Service Area
Close Button
Search for:
Cura Sod Corporation in Land O Lakes, FL 34638
Cura Sod Corporation
2515 Hunt Road
(813) 948-2528
http://sodcura.com